Hot Water Soak Method
The hot water soak method is a gentle yet effective way to remove candle wax from candelabras, leveraging the simple principle of heat to soften and loosen wax without damaging delicate surfaces. Unlike scraping or freezing, this method minimizes the risk of scratching metal or leaving residue behind. It’s particularly ideal for intricate or antique candelabras where precision is key.
To begin, fill a basin or sink with hot water—not boiling, as extreme temperatures can warp certain metals. The water should be hot enough to melt wax but safe to handle, typically around 120°F to 140°F. Submerge the wax-covered portions of the candelabra, ensuring the water level is high enough to cover the affected areas. Let it soak for 10 to 15 minutes, allowing the heat to penetrate and soften the wax. For stubborn buildup, extend the soak time by 5-minute increments, checking periodically to avoid overheating.
After soaking, remove the candelabra and gently wipe away the softened wax with a soft cloth or paper towel. Work carefully to avoid smearing the wax onto clean areas. For remaining residue, use a wooden or plastic utensil (never metal) to coax out wax from crevices. Follow up with a mild dish soap solution and a soft-bristled brush to clean any lingering oils or discoloration.
While this method is versatile, it’s not one-size-fits-all. Avoid using it on candelabras with glued components, painted finishes, or materials like wood, which can warp or discolor when exposed to prolonged moisture. Always test a small, inconspicuous area first to ensure compatibility. Freezing Technique for Easy Removal
Candle wax spills on candelabras can be stubborn, but the freezing technique offers a surprisingly effective solution. This method leverages the principle that wax contracts when exposed to cold temperatures, making it easier to remove without damaging delicate surfaces. By applying cold to the wax, you can shrink it, harden it, and lift it away with minimal effort.
To begin, place the candelabra in a plastic bag or wrap it in plastic wrap to protect it from moisture. Then, put the wrapped candelabra in the freezer, ensuring it sits on a flat surface to prevent spills. Leave it there for at least 2–3 hours, or until the wax is completely hardened. The colder the temperature, the more effective the contraction, so aim for a freezer set at 0°F (-18°C) or lower. For larger candelabras or thicker wax buildup, consider extending the freezing time to 4–6 hours for optimal results.
Once the wax is frozen, remove the candelabra from the freezer and unwrap it. Use a butter knife or a plastic scraper to gently lift the wax from the surface. Start at the edges and work inward, applying minimal pressure to avoid scratching the candelabra. The frozen wax should chip or pop off easily, leaving behind a clean surface. For stubborn residue, a soft-bristled brush or a cloth dampened with warm water can be used to wipe away any remaining traces.
This technique is particularly useful for intricate candelabras with hard-to-reach crevices, as the hardened wax can be dislodged without the need for harsh chemicals or excessive scrubbing. However, caution should be exercised with candelabras made of materials sensitive to temperature changes, such as certain metals or glass. Always test the method on a small area first to ensure it doesn’t cause damage. Using a Hairdryer to Melt Wax
A hairdryer can be an effective tool for removing candle wax from a candelabra, but it requires precision and caution. Start by setting the hairdryer to a medium heat setting to avoid overheating the wax or damaging the candelabra. Hold the dryer 6–8 inches away from the wax, moving it in a circular motion to evenly distribute the heat. This method works best for small to moderate amounts of wax and is particularly useful for intricate candelabra designs where scraping or peeling might cause harm.
The science behind this technique is straightforward: heat softens wax, making it easier to remove. However, the key is to melt the wax just enough to loosen it without turning it into a liquid that could drip and create a mess. Once the wax begins to soften, use a soft cloth or paper towel to gently wipe it away. For stubborn areas, a plastic scraper can be used, but avoid metal tools that could scratch the candelabra’s surface. This method is ideal for brass, glass, or metal candelabras, but exercise caution with painted or delicate materials.
One practical tip is to place a sheet of parchment paper or a plastic bag beneath the candelabra to catch any wax that drips during the process. This makes cleanup significantly easier. Additionally, work in a well-ventilated area to avoid inhaling heated wax fumes, which can be unpleasant. If the wax is particularly thick, you may need to repeat the process in layers, gradually removing the wax without overwhelming the candelabra with excessive heat.
Comparatively, using a hairdryer is less risky than methods involving freezing or chemical solvents, which can be messy or harmful to certain materials. It’s also more accessible than specialized tools like heat guns, which can be too powerful for delicate candelabras. However, it’s not the fastest method—expect to spend 10–15 minutes per candlestick, depending on the wax buildup. Patience is key to achieving a clean, undamaged result.

Cleaning with Vinegar and Baking Soda
Vinegar and baking soda, two household staples, form a dynamic duo for tackling stubborn candle wax on candelabras. This natural cleaning combination leverages the acidic nature of vinegar and the gentle abrasiveness of baking soda to dissolve and lift wax without harsh chemicals. The reaction between the two creates carbon dioxide bubbles, which help to break down the wax, making it easier to remove.
The Process Unveiled: Begin by gently scraping off excess wax with a plastic scraper or butter knife, taking care not to scratch the candelabra's surface. Next, mix equal parts warm water and white vinegar in a bowl, and dip a soft cloth into the solution. Wring out the excess and lay the cloth over the wax residue for about 15 minutes. The vinegar's acidity will start to soften the wax. Meanwhile, create a paste by mixing three parts baking soda with one part water. After removing the vinegar-soaked cloth, apply the paste to the wax, allowing it to sit for 10 minutes. The baking soda will absorb the wax and any remaining odors. Finally, wipe away the paste with a damp cloth and buff the candelabra to a shine with a dry microfiber cloth.
Dosage and Cautions: For delicate or antique candelabras, test the vinegar solution on a small, inconspicuous area first to ensure it doesn’t damage the finish. Use white vinegar exclusively, as other types may stain. When mixing the baking soda paste, aim for a thick consistency to prevent dripping. Avoid using this method on candelabras with painted or lacquered surfaces, as the vinegar may strip the coating.
Comparative Advantage: Unlike commercial wax removers, which often contain harsh solvents, the vinegar and baking soda method is eco-friendly, cost-effective, and safe for most materials. It’s particularly useful for intricate candelabra designs where wax accumulates in hard-to-reach crevices. While it may require more elbow grease than chemical alternatives, the natural approach ensures no toxic residues are left behind.
Practical Tips for Success: For heavily waxed candelabras, repeat the vinegar soak and baking soda paste application as needed. To prevent future buildup, consider using drip-less candles or placing a small tray beneath the candelabra to catch excess wax. Store vinegar and baking soda in a cool, dry place to maintain their effectiveness for future cleaning tasks. Scraping and Polishing Candelabra Safely
Candle wax can accumulate on candelabra, dulling their beauty and potentially damaging delicate surfaces if not removed carefully. Scraping and polishing are effective methods to restore their luster, but they require precision and the right tools to avoid scratches or further harm. Here’s how to approach this task safely and effectively.
Begin by gathering the necessary tools: a plastic scraper (avoid metal to prevent scratches), a soft-bristled brush, mild dish soap, warm water, and a polishing cloth. For stubborn wax, a hairdryer set on low heat can be used to soften the wax without overheating the metal. Start by gently scraping off the bulk of the wax with the plastic scraper, working at a 45-degree angle to minimize pressure on the surface. Be particularly cautious around intricate designs or thin areas where the metal is more vulnerable.
After scraping, use the soft-bristled brush to remove any remaining wax particles from crevices. Follow this by cleaning the candelabra with a mixture of warm water and mild dish soap, ensuring all soap residue is rinsed off to prevent tarnishing. Once clean, dry the candelabra thoroughly with a soft cloth to avoid water spots. For a polished finish, apply a metal-specific polish sparingly and buff with a microfiber cloth in circular motions. This not only enhances shine but also adds a protective layer against future wax buildup.
While scraping and polishing, avoid aggressive techniques that could mar the surface. For antique or valuable candelabra, consider consulting a professional to ensure preservation. Regular maintenance, such as wiping down the candelabra after each use, can reduce the need for intensive cleaning.
